CHOCOLATE PECAN PIE II

Yield 8

Number Of Ingredients 10

2 (9 inch) unbaked pie crust
4 eggs, beaten
¾ cup white sugar
¼ cup packed brown sugar
1 tablespoon all-purpose flour
½ cup butter, softened
1 cup light corn syrup
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
1 cup semi-sweet chocolate chips
1 cup chopped pecans

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
  • In a large bowl, blend together the eggs, white sugar, brown sugar, flour, butter, corn syrup and vanilla.
  • Add the chocolate chips and pecans; mix well and pour into pie crusts.
  • Bake at 350 degrees F (175 degrees C) for 40 to 45 minutes.
